2. Black cohosh (Cimicifuga racemosa)

cimicifuga racemosa lozenge

Cimicifuga racemosa, commonly known as black cohosh, is a traditional herbal remedy often used to support hormonal balance, particularly in women experiencing symptoms related to menopause.

Herbal lozenges containing Cimicifuga racemosa are designed to provide a convenient and consistent dosage of the herb, making them a popular choice for managing symptoms such as hot flashes, mood swings, and sleep disturbances. These lozenges are typically standardized to contain specific levels of active compounds, such as triterpene glycosides, which are believed to influence hormonal activity in the body. While generally considered safe for short-term use, it is important to consult a healthcare provider before starting any herbal supplement, especially for individuals with pre-existing medical conditions or those taking other medications.

Overall, Cimicifuga racemosa lozenges may offer a natural alternative for supporting hormonal health, though their effectiveness can vary among individuals.

3. Licorice (Glycyrrhiza glabra)

glycyrrhiza glabra lozenge

Glycyrrhiza glabra, commonly known as licorice root, has been traditionally used in herbal medicine for its potential to support hormonal balance.

Herbal lozenges made from licorice root may help regulate cortisol levels, which can be beneficial for individuals experiencing stress-related hormonal fluctuations. The active compounds in licorice, such as glycyrrhizin, possess anti-inflammatory and adaptogenic properties that may aid in managing hormonal imbalances. However, prolonged use of licorice root can lead to side effects like hypertension due to its effect on mineralocorticoid receptors.

As with any herbal remedy, it is advisable to consult a healthcare professional before incorporating licorice lozenges into a hormonal health regimen.
